    My Wife and i just came back from Northwest of Tasmania and this is what I was able to retrieve from a couple of woodpiles. They burn it!!!!

    The first two images are the woodheap stuff. The large piece in the second image is a piece of Blackwood about 380x120x60 which came from Arthur River. The rest came from Stanley.

    The wood in the third image comes from Wild Wood near Stanley (not free like the rest). It was a bit like a kid in a Candy store.

    I am going to make some pens and a couple of clocks from it. More to follow as I get through it.

    It is a beautiful area. If you get the chance go and see it.
